Below is an example of my QlikView query I need help with, followed by an example of the resultant dataset.
Query:
LOAD DISTINCT
ISSUEID,
CODE,
DATE,
TYPE,
ACTION
FROM
WHERE (DATE > Date(AddYears(Today(),-2)));
Dataset:
Now, I need to exclude not only the rows where the ACTION = 'Withdrawn', but I also need to exclude all rows that belong to the same ISSUEID and have the same TYPE (in this case, 'Short Term Rating') as the 'Withdrawn' row - so, in the above example, I need to retain the rows where the TYPE='Long Term Rating', but I want to get rid of the rows with a TYPE of 'Short Term Rating', because one of them has an ACTION of 'Withdrawn'.
So I need to find a way to exclude rows which share the same values (ISSUEID, ACTION and TYPE) in another row - how can I do this in a LOAD statement?

I'm not quite sure if this will help but have you tried the Peek function?
It allows you to see the previous rows data.
For example:
peek([Fieldname]) will give you the value of Fieldname from the previous record read.

Thank you, but I don't think peek() will help, because the rows I need to exclude may not be immediately preceding each other - they may not be in consecutive rows within the dataset. What I'd like is the QlikView equivalent of this PL/SQL:
SELECT * from data WHERE issueid IN (SELECT issueid FROM data WHERE action = 'Withdrawn' AND type = 'Long Term Rating');
